How the Age Calculator App Handles Leap Years and Calendar Rules
The Gregorian calendar, which governs most modern administrative systems, does not align perfectly with solar time. A solar year lasts approximately 365.2425 days. To compensate, the calendar inserts a 366th day every 4 years. Century years break this pattern unless they are evenly divisible by 400 (1900 was not a leap year, but 2000 was).
The calculator requires your exact date of birth and a target date, which defaults to the current date. It uses a progressive subtraction algorithm to count fully completed years first, then calculates remaining calendar months, and finally determines leftover days. The logic automatically adjusts for 28-day February months, 30-day months, and 31-day months without averaging them to 30.44 days. When you enable hourly precision, the engine applies timezone offsets and daylight saving transitions to output exact hours elapsed since birth.

Why Does Manual Age Math Often Produce Incorrect Results?
Human calculation relies on fixed multipliers that do not reflect calendar reality. Assuming every month equals 30 days introduces a compound error of 1 to 3 days per month. Ignoring the 29th of February adds a full day of error for every leap year traversed. Boundary counting also causes frequent mistakes: someone born on January 15 and measured on February 14 has completed 0 full months, not 1. Automated tools remove these boundary condition errors by counting actual calendar days between two fixed points.

Practical Use Cases for Precise Age Tracking
Exact chronological breakdowns serve specific administrative and personal functions:
- Immigration and visa compliance: Many countries set strict age thresholds (18, 21, or 65) that require exact month and day verification rather than calendar year subtraction.
- Pediatric medicine: Vaccination schedules, medication dosages, and developmental milestone tracking depend on age accurate to the day at birth.
- Financial planning: Retirement accounts, insurance premiums, and trust distributions trigger based on exact birth anniversaries, not fiscal years.
- Animal age conversion: Veterinary guidelines use precise chronological age to determine life stage equivalents and recommended dietary adjustments.
- Anniversary planning: Tracking exact elapsed time helps organize milestone celebrations, vow renewals, or professional service anniversaries with day-level accuracy.
